Job Description The Sr. Food Scientist - R&D will lead and execute research projects focused on dairy-based ingredients, enzyme hydrolysis, and flavor formulation. This position requires a strong scientific foundation in food science, chemistry, biochemistry, biotechnology or a related field, problem-solving skills, and the ability to collaborate across teams to drive innovation and process. In addition, this role is responsible for designing and conducting experiments, performing instrumental and analytical testing, interpreting data, and supporting product development initiatives for scale-up and commercialization. While not a managerial position, the Sr. Scientist will oversee one direct report, the R&D Lab Assistant, ensuring efficient laboratory operations and experimental support improvements.
